☐ Night-Shift Access — Support Team (Calders Row)

On your first day, collect your lanyard from the duty lead and confirm you're on the overnight roster. After 22:00, only the rear entrance is active, so use that door for all breaks. Sign the night log each time you enter or leave the building. The rear entrance code for your first week is below.

turnstile pass: bdg-TDUNI-3

## Authentication

Maintainers: the resolver shim exists because Fernwick's internal DNS intermittently drops AAAA answers, so this service pins the auth endpoint by address and re-resolves hourly. If auth calls fail with timeouts, suspect DNS before credentials. All requests to the token broker use the internal service key, which is provided on the line below.

app token of kagap-fahag = zpat2_0m

# Build Provenance: Tidewick Widget

The tide-table widget ships as a single signed bundle built by the Harrowport pipeline. Each build records the source revision, predictor dataset version, and the toolchain digest in its manifest. New team members: never deploy a bundle whose manifest fails verification, even on staging. The token identifying the current production build is listed below.

session token of tajog-fahaf = htk21_4ae55819f45410afcb307

Handover: Payroll Export Change (Lumenfold Payday)

Taking over from me, note that the Payday export moved from fixed-width to delimited records in the v9 format so the Kestrelbank intake can parse decimals without the old implied-two-places rule. Amounts are now explicit with a decimal point, and the header row carries a schema version. The nightly job validates row counts against the ledger before upload; a mismatch aborts the run. The exporter currently runs with these values:

service settings:
PRAIX_LOG_LEVEL=error
PRAIX_METRICS_HOST=metrics.praix.qorvelcorp.corp
PRAIX_POOL_SIZE=16